Calculate the following values and indicate what type of electromagnetic radiation is present.
(a) Energy for 635 nm light
(b)Frequency for 3.50 um light
(c) Wavelength for 2.1 x 1018 Hz radiation
(d)Wavenumber for 5.5 x 1011 Hz radiation
